Output 34c5e073281a80e3a81cbfbab03ede265efd836754af78c4623987cad8882ed3:0

value
19309399
script pubkey
OP_0 OP_PUSHBYTES_20 67975448040a00dfce90cb4459c033122c22e095
address
bc1qv7t4gjqypgqdln5sedz9nspnzgkz9cy4g6xjem
transaction
34c5e073281a80e3a81cbfbab03ede265efd836754af78c4623987cad8882ed3